Kenworth has introduced the T880E, the first Class 8 battery-electric truck designed specifically for vocational applications in North America. Debuted at ACT Expo, the new model expands the company’s electric vehicle offerings to include work-focused operations such as construction, refuse, and utility service.

The T880E is built on the PACCAR-developed ePowertrain platform and delivers between 365 to 470 horsepower in continuous output, with up to 605 horsepower at peak and 1,850 lb.-ft. of torque. The truck is designed to support a range of demanding job site requirements, offering flexibility in battery capacity and vehicle configuration.

Four battery-string options are available, enabling a driving range of 100 to over 250 miles depending on the setup. The largest battery pack offers 625 kWh of energy storage and supports gross vehicle weight ratings (GVWR) up to 82,000 pounds. Charging is handled through a CCS1 DC port, which supports a peak charge rate of 350 kW—allowing up to 90% battery charge in around two hours.

The central motor design supports a variety of vocational configurations, including lift axles and custom wheelbases. The T880E is also equipped with high- and low-voltage ePTO ports, providing power to external equipment and making it compatible with body upfitters.

Interior features include a 15-inch DriverConnect digital touchscreen and Kenworth’s SmartWheel system. Additional options include advanced driver assistance technologies such as Bendix Fusion, Lane Keeping Assist, and DigitalVision mirror systems. The T880E retains many characteristics of the diesel-powered T880, including both set-forward and set-back front axle layouts and multi-piece hood construction.

Customer orders for the T880E are open in the U.S. and Canada, with deliveries expected later this year.
